Busy busy week and the weather has been splendid for all outdoors activities. Mr and
I went to Chartwell , near Westerham .It is a place we visit very often just to wander in the garden . Sometimes, when it is not crowded late or early season we will go into the house. This was the home of Sir Winston Churchill. A beautiful house and splendid gardens.
